Pharmaceutical Recyclable Blister Packaging in Malaysia Trends and Forecast
The future of the pharmaceutical recyclable blister packaging market in Malaysia looks promising with opportunities in the pharmaceutical and health care product markets. The global pharmaceutical recyclable blister packaging market is expected to grow with a CAGR of 6.1% from 2025 to 2031. The pharmaceutical recyclable blister packaging market in Malaysia is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the rising environmental concerns & regulations, the growing demand for sustainable healthcare packaging, and the increasing adoption by pharmaceutical manufacturers.
• Lucintel forecasts that, within the type category, PET material is expected to witness higher growth over the forecast period.
• Within the application category, pharmaceutical is expected to witness higher growth.

The challenges in the pharmaceutical recyclable blister packaging market in Malaysia are:-
• High Production Costs: Developing and manufacturing recyclable blister packaging often involves higher costs compared to traditional options. Advanced materials, specialized machinery, and quality control measures increase overall expenses. These costs can be a barrier for small and medium-sized pharmaceutical companies, limiting widespread adoption. Additionally, economies of scale are still developing in Malaysia, which can hinder cost competitiveness and slow market growth.
• Stringent Regulatory Compliance: Navigating complex regulatory frameworks for pharmaceutical packaging presents a significant challenge. Malaysia’s strict standards for drug safety, packaging materials, and environmental impact require continuous compliance efforts. Meeting these standards involves rigorous testing, certification, and documentation, which can delay product launches and increase costs. Non-compliance risks include legal penalties and damage to brand reputation, making regulatory adherence a critical concern.
• Supply Chain Disruptions: The availability of recyclable materials and reliable supply chains can be inconsistent, especially in a developing market like Malaysia. Disruptions caused by global supply chain issues, raw material shortages, or logistical inefficiencies can hinder production schedules. Ensuring a steady supply of high-quality recyclable materials is essential for maintaining product quality and meeting market demand, but current supply chain vulnerabilities pose ongoing risks.
